London police are still finalizing their investigation (their 2nd) .. its still very active.

Incident happened in June 2018.. they were at a HC fund raiser in London (golf tournament)
London police originally investigated the allegations in 2018 and closed the file in 2019 with no charges laid.

The woman sued Hockey Canada in 2022 for $3.55M..

HC settled out of court with her in May 2022.

Federal ministry of sport got involved, sponsors pulled out.. HC reopened investigation through a 3rd party in July 2022 and finalized it in Dec 2022.

London police had reopened the investigation sometime in 2022, and were given the 3rd party's final report..

So a long process, as it stands looks like they are still waiting for London police to conclude their investigation and file charges, if any. Could be a bombshell.
